Why Community Gardens? The Stakes and Reader Context
For many aspiring horticulturists, the path to a propagation career feels blocked by a lack of formal training or paid experience. Traditional education can be expensive and time-consuming, while entry-level positions often require skills you haven't had a chance to develop. This is where community gardens step in as low-barrier, high-impact training grounds. They offer hands-on practice with plants, soil, and people—all essential for propagation work. One Dynama member described starting as a volunteer at a small neighborhood plot, unsure even how to take a cutting. Within two seasons, that same person was leading a seed-saving workshop and later landed a job at a native plant nursery. The stakes are clear: community gardens provide a real-world laboratory where you can fail safely, learn quickly, and build a portfolio of practical skills that employers value.

Step 2: Preparation and Sterilization
Cleanliness is critical in propagation to prevent disease. Before taking cuttings, sterilize tools with rubbing alcohol or a 10% bleach solution. Prepare your propagation medium—a mix of perlite and peat moss or a commercial seed-starting mix—and moisten it evenly. Dynama members stressed that many failures stem from contaminated tools or overly wet medium. One member described a season where they lost 40% of cuttings to rot because they skipped sterilization. After implementing a strict protocol, success rates jumped to 85%. Documenting these steps in a log helps identify patterns and improve over time.
Step 3: Taking Cuttings
For softwood cuttings, take 4-6 inch sections from new growth in spring or early summer. Cut just below a node, remove lower leaves, and dip the cut end in rooting hormone if desired. Insert the cutting into the propagation medium, firming the soil around it. Label each cutting with the species and date. One Dynama member found that using clear plastic cups as mini-greenhouses helped maintain humidity and allowed them to observe root development without disturbing the cutting. They also grouped cuttings by species to ensure consistent care.
Step 4: Aftercare and Monitoring
Place cuttings in a warm, bright location out of direct sun. Maintain humidity by covering with a plastic bag or dome, and mist as needed. Check for roots after 2-4 weeks by gently tugging—if there is resistance, roots have formed. Gradually acclimate rooted cuttings to lower humidity over a week before transplanting. Dynama members emphasized patience: rushing to transplant can shock young roots. One member kept a daily log of temperature, humidity, and watering, which helped them fine-tune conditions for different species.
Step 5: Transplanting and Hardening Off
Once cuttings have a robust root system (several inches long), transplant them into individual pots with standard potting soil. Harden them off over 7-10 days by exposing them to outdoor conditions gradually. This step is crucial for survival in the garden. One Dynama member described a heartbreak when they lost 30 well-rooted cuttings because they skipped hardening off and a heatwave hit. Now they use a shaded cold frame for the transition period and monitor weather forecasts closely. The experience taught them that propagation doesn't end when roots appear—it continues until the plant is established in its final location.

Essential Tools and Their Costs
A basic propagation toolkit includes pruning shears ($15-$30), a sharp knife ($10-$20), rooting hormone powder ($8-$15), propagation trays ($5-$15 each), a misting bottle ($5-$10), and labels ($5 for a pack). Many community gardens have shared tool libraries, reducing individual costs. One Dynama member noted that investing in a heat mat ($30-$50) dramatically improved rooting success for warm-season plants, especially in cooler climates. However, they cautioned that heat mats can dry out medium quickly, requiring more frequent monitoring. It is wise to start with the basics and add specialized tools as your propagation volume grows.
Economic Considerations: Budgeting for Propagation
Community gardens often operate on tight budgets. Propagation can be a cost-effective way to expand plant inventory, but it still requires upfront investment in supplies. Dynama members recommended starting a propagation fund separate from general garden funds, with proceeds from plant sales reinvested into supplies. One garden used a simple spreadsheet to track expenses (soil, pots, labels) against revenue from plant sales. They found that propagation paid for itself within two seasons, with a 200% return on investment when selling popular perennials. However, labor costs (volunteer time) are often not accounted for, so it is important to value volunteer contributions realistically.

Risks, Pitfalls, Mistakes, and Mitigations
Even with the best intentions, community garden propagation can go wrong. Dynama members candidly shared the mistakes they made and how they recovered. Understanding these pitfalls can save you time, plants, and frustration. This section covers common risks and actionable mitigations.
Pitfall 1: Overwatering and Root Rot
Overwatering is the most common cause of cutting failure. New propagators often think more water equals better growth, but saturated medium suffocates roots and invites fungal diseases. Mitigation: Use a well-draining propagation mix (e.g., 50% perlite, 50% peat) and water only when the top inch feels dry. One Dynama member lost an entire tray of lavender cuttings to rot before switching to a bottom-watering method that kept the medium moist but not wet. They now check moisture with a wooden skewer—if it comes out clean, it's time to water.
Pitfall 2: Poor Timing and Seasonality
Taking cuttings at the wrong time of year reduces success rates. Softwood cuttings need active growth in spring or early summer; hardwood cuttings are best taken in dormant seasons. Ignoring these windows leads to low rooting percentages. Mitigation: Research optimal timing for each species and create a seasonal calendar. Dynama members recommended joining a local horticulture society or extension service for region-specific guidance. One member learned the hard way that taking cuttings from a stressed plant in late summer resulted in zero roots—now they mark optimal windows on their garden calendar.
Pitfall 3: Neglecting Hygiene
Using dirty tools or contaminated medium introduces pathogens that can wipe out a batch. Mitigation: Sterilize tools before each use, use fresh propagation medium, and dispose of any diseased plant material immediately. One Dynama member described a season where they reused soil from old pots without sterilization, leading to a fungal outbreak that killed 60% of seedlings. Now they always use sterile medium or pasteurize soil in an oven (at 180°F for 30 minutes) for small batches. The extra effort pays off in higher success rates.
Pitfall 4: Lack of Documentation
Without records, you cannot learn from successes or failures. Mitigation: Keep a simple log—species, date taken, medium used, rooting hormone, success rate, and notes. Over time, this log becomes a personalized guide. Dynama members emphasized that documentation also impresses employers, as it shows a systematic approach. One member's propagation log was the deciding factor in a job offer because the employer valued data-driven decision-making. Start with a notebook or spreadsheet and update it weekly.
